Which airline give employees fly free?

Employees have free, unlimited travel privileges for themselves and eligible dependents on Southwest Airlines. Eligible dependents include spouse or committed/registered partner, eligible dependent children under 19 years old (or up to 24 if a full-time student), and parents.

Can airline employees fly first class?

Different airlines have different policies when it comes to the flight benefits that employees receive. At many airlines in Europe, employees can fly up to business class on a space available basis, but never first class. At other airlines it depends on your rank, and only select employees can fly first class.

What is a buddy pass flight?

Buddy Passes are standby passes. Essentially you are borrowing your friend's or family's flight benefit. Flying on a buddy pass, you are flying standby. This means you only get on the plane if there are empty seats after all paying customers have boarded. Buddy passes are NOT a confirmed seat.

Do American Airlines employees fly free?

Free Flights (If Space Available) - Unlimited space available travel for free for all employees, domestic partners/spouses, children, parents/in-laws (small fee) and 16 buddy passes/year (small fee). Can travel anywhere, anytime on AA, Delta, United and all other partner airlines.

Do baggage handlers get free flights?

Job Benefits

Typically, even new-hire airline baggage handlers receive free space-available flight benefits for themselves and their families. Depending on airline size, new-hire baggage handlers also receive paid sick time, a retirement plan and access to dental, life and accident insurance.

Do pilots get free hotels?

The airline handles and pays for accommodations for crewmembers when they are on a trip. Many pilots do not live where they are based and choose to commute. Generally, if pilots need to travel and stay away from home when they are not on a trip, they are responsible for their own accommodations.
